1. Given below are the two statements, one labelled as Assertion (A), and the other labelled as Reason (R). (SEPT 2013)

Assertion (A): Regional development planning solves the problem of regional disparities created by sectoral planning.
Reason (R): Sectoral planning concentrates on sectoral growth ignoring regional balance and regional development planning takes care of the growth and development of the delineated regions.

Codes:
(1) Both (A) and (R) are true and (R) is the correct explanation of (A)
(2) Both (A) and (R) are true, but (R) is not the correct explanation of (A)
(3) (A) is true, but (R) is false
(4) (A) is false, but (R) is true


2. Which of the following was the earliest regional planning exercise in India? (DEC 2013)

(1) National Capital Region Plan
(2) Dandakaranya Area Plan
(3) Damodar Valley Project
(4) Bhakra-Nangal Project


3. Which of the following is an incorrect pair? (DEC 2013)

(1) Utilitarian Planning – Functional Planning
(2) Comprehensive Planning – Integrated Planning
(3) Regional Planning – Spatial Planning
(4) Sectoral Planning – Coordinated Planning


4. Machu Picchu of Inca civilisation is located in: (DEC 2013)

(1) Argentina
(2) Brazil
(3) Columbia
(4) Peru


5. Who has defined that “there is only one region on the surface of the Earth on which mankind finds its home”? (JUNE 2014)

(1) Minshull
(2) Vidal de la Blasche
(3) Fenneman
(4) Herbertson


6. Given below are two statements, one labelled as Assertion (A) and the other labelled as Reason (R). (JUNE 2014)

Assertion (A): There are regional disparities in the spatial organisation of the economy.
Reason (R): Interactions among inherent factors in economic activities affect the texture of spatial organizations.

Codes:
(1) Both (A) and (R) are true and (R) is the correct explanation of (A)
(2) Both (A) and (R) are true, but (R) is not the correct explanation of (A)
(3) (A) is true, but (R) is false
(4) (A) is false, but (R) is true


7. The concept of ‘spread’ and ‘backwash’ effects were introduced by: (DEC 2014)

(1) A. O. Hirschman
(2) Gunnar Myrdal
(3) Gunder Frank
(4) Sameer Amin


8. Regional imbalances of economic development are largely affected by which of the following factors? (DEC 2014)

(1) Regional disparity in resources
(2) Lesser resource utilization
(3) Lack of education
(4) Lesser demand of the people


9. Match List I with List II and select the correct answer. (DEC 2014)

List-I (Planning Programmes)List-II (Associated features)
A. Metropolitan PlanningI. Command area
B. Tribal Area PlanningII. Upgradation of urban infrastructure
C. JNNURMIII. Social and cultural sensibility
D. River Basin PlanningIV. Green belt

Codes:
(1) A-I, B-II, C-III, D-IV
(2) A-IV, B-III, C-I, D-II
(3) A-III, B-IV, C-II, D-I
(4) A-IV, B-III, C-II, D-I


10. Whose theory propagated that “an area is poor because it is poor”? (JUNE 2015)

(1) Myrdal
(2) Berry
(3) Hirschman
(4) Boudeville
